Ist answer
During electron transport chain electrons are donated by reduced coenzymes such as NADH and FADH2.
2nd answer
During electron transport chain oxygen or O2 act as terminal electron acceptor which accepts and then undergo reduction to generate H2O.
3rd answer
The final products of electron transport chain and oxidative phosphorylation are NAD+, FAD,H2O and ATP.
